One of the main reasons why artificial intelligence is becoming increasingly integral to information security is its ability to sift through vast amounts of data in real-time Traditional cybersecurity measures often rely on rule-based systems that are limited in their ability to detect and respond to new and evolving threats AI, on the other hand, can analyze patterns and anomalies in data at a speed and scale that humans simply cannot match By leveraging machine learning algorithms, AI systems can continuously learn from past incidents and adapt to new threats, making them highly effective at thwarting cyber attacks.
One of the key ways in which AI is being used in information security is through the development of predictive analytics By analyzing historical data and identifying patterns, AI can help organizations anticipate potential security risks and take preemptive measures to mitigate them For example, AI can identify unusual patterns of behavior on a network that may indicate a cyber attack in progress By predicting these threats before they occur, organizations can proactively protect their data and prevent costly breaches.

AI is also being used to enhance endpoint security, which refers to the protection of individual devices such as laptops, smartphones, and IoT devices With the proliferation of connected devices in today’s digital world, endpoint security has become a critical aspect of information security AI can help organizations monitor and secure these devices by identifying vulnerabilities and potential threats For example, AI-powered endpoint security solutions can detect malware infections, unauthorized access attempts, and other security risks in real-time, allowing organizations to quickly respond and mitigate potential damage.
In addition to threat detection and response, AI can also be used to improve access control and authentication processes By analyzing user behavior and biometric data, AI can help organizations verify the identity of individuals accessing their systems and ensure that only authorized users are granted access to sensitive information For example, AI can analyze typing patterns, mouse movements, and other behavioral biometrics to detect suspicious activities and prevent unauthorized access By strengthening access control measures, AI can help organizations protect their data from insider threats and unauthorized access.
